초록

Background and Objectives: The effect of pulmonary vasodilator therapy on patients with Fontan circulation remains unclear. This study aims to assess its impact on exercise capacity and hemodynamic parameters in this population. Methods: We searched PubMed, Embase, and the Cochrane Library for relevant studies up to November 2023. Pooled outcomes were used to evaluate the efficacy of pulmonary vasodilators in Fontan patients. Results: A total of 18 studies with 667 patients were included. Exercise capacity was assessed in 14 studies (526 patients). Pulmonary vasodilator therapy improved oxygen consumption anaerobic threshold (VO2AT; MD, 1.12 mL/min/kg; 95% CI, 0.35 to 1.89; p=0.004) and Ve/ VCO2 slope (MD, −1.14; 95% CI, −1.97 to −0.31; p=0.007) during exercise. No significant differences were found among drug classes regarding peak oxygen consumption, Ve/VCO2, or VO2AT. Invasive hemodynamics were evaluated in 6 studies (126 patients). Pulmonary vasodilators significantly reduced mean pulmonary arterial pressure (MD, −2.28 mmHg; p=0.02), pulmonary vascular resistance (MD, −0.91 WU*m2; p=0.01), and improved pulmonary flow (MD, 0.46 L/min/m2; p=0.02). Conclusions: Pulmonary vasodilator therapy appears beneficial for exercise capacity and pulmonary hemodynamics in Fontan patients. More randomized controlled trials are needed to confirm these findings.
